At Circle 22 Cattle Ranch, we offer both methods of cattle sales to accommodate the varied needs of our clients. Our primary, and preferred method is Private Treaty sales, where buyers can directly negotiate with us to purchase our high-quality Black Angus cows, calves, and bulls. This approach allows for more personalized transactions and the opportunity to thoroughly inspect the livestock before making a purchase. Additionally, we do participate in sales at local sale barns, providing an opportunity for buyers who prefer or find convenience in this traditional market setting. Regardless of the method, we are committed to ensuring the health, quality, and genetic excellence of our cattle to meet the standards our clients expect.
